Strange search results to Bermuda on delta.com

I am going to Bermuda over thanksgiving. I am flying out on November 20th and flying back on Nov. 25. I will get one result with a not crazy layover and then 10 with 19 hour layovers in Detroit or La Guardia. What up? Will I need to call? I'm starting and ending at my family's place in MSN.

Not unusual-- short BDA connections are sparse. It's an international flight, so you get 24 hours to make the connection. Make a day trip into the connecting city if you want.

From MSN, you might be able to force the routing through MSP if desired.

Some folks here would take the attitude that if the journey will be long anyway, they prefer to add a segment or lots of MQMs rather than waiting at an airport.

Others would plan to use the long connection as a way to get a "free" day in NYC or someplace else that's an interesting spot to spend some time.

DL agents aren't going to magically find anything that can't be found on Google Flights or ITA Matrix. There are far more flight options to LAX than there are to BDA, so not exactly a fair comparison.

Using Google flights and setting the duration slider to 9 hours (to filter out overnights) show the following as the shortest:

11/20 MSN->ATL->BDA DL 1981,656 6h 50m
11/25 BDA->BOS->DTW->MSN DL 126,1523,870 8h 00m

$994.56

Alternatively, you can avoid the double connect on the return and get a lower price by flying out of MKE (a bit longer travel time on the return):

11/20 MKE->ATL->BDA DL 2539,656 5h 40m
11/25 BDA->BOS->MKE DL 126,3843 8h 34m

$775.06

BDA flights really drop off during the autumn and winter, given the weather. AA will give you some really crAAzy connection times (8 hours)!

I'm not really sure how DL maintains their service from BOS, but its convenient (really enjoy the Fairmont Southampton). Anyways, if you can get to BOS, there is that DL non-stop and the fares are generally reasonable that time of year.
